Do I need a referral letter from MOM to engage a designated workplace doctor or service provider to conduct audiometric examinations for my employees?

You do not need a referral letter from MOM to engage a DWD or service provider to conduct audiometric examinations for your employees.  Your company may engage a service provider from MOM's published list of industrial audiometric examination service providers. These providers are familiar with MOM's requirements and will help ensure your compliance professionally.

Under the Workplace Safety and Health (Medical Examinations) Regulations, it is the duty of the employer to ensure that their employees who are exposed to excessive noise undergo pre-placement and periodic medical examinations by a Designated Workplace Doctors (DWD).
